The role of big data analysis is crucial in today's digital world. By harnessing the power of advanced technologies and tools, big data analysis helps organizations make informed decisions, improve processes, enhance customer experiences, and drive innovation. Here are some key aspects of the importance of big data analysis:
-
Decision Making: Big data analysis provides valuable insights by analyzing large volumes of structured and unstructured data. This enables organizations to make data-driven decisions based on facts and trends rather than intuition or guesswork.
-
Predictive Analytics: Big data analysis allows organizations to predict future trends and behavior by analyzing historical data. This helps in forecasting demand, identifying potential risks, and seizing new opportunities in the market.
-
Enhanced Customer Insights: By analyzing customer data from various sources, organizations can gain a deeper understanding of customer preferences, behavior, and sentiment. This enables targeted marketing campaigns, personalized recommendations, and improved customer satisfaction.
-
Operational Efficiency: Big data analysis helps organizations optimize their operations by identifying inefficiencies, streamlining processes, and reducing costs. It can also help in predictive maintenance, supply chain optimization, and resource allocation.
-
Innovation: Big data analysis fuels innovation by uncovering new patterns, trends, and correlations in data. This can lead to the development of new products and services, as well as improvements in existing offerings.
-
Risk Management: By analyzing data related to risks and uncertainties, organizations can better assess and mitigate potential threats. Big data analysis can help in fraud detection, cybersecurity, and compliance with regulations.
-
Competitive Advantage: Organizations that effectively leverage big data analysis gain a competitive edge in the market. By understanding market trends, customer preferences, and competitors' strategies, they can make strategic decisions that set them apart from the competition.
In conclusion, big data analysis plays a vital role in helping organizations harness the power of data to drive business success. By enabling data-driven decision-making, predictive analytics, enhanced customer insights, operational efficiency, innovation, risk management, and competitive advantage, big data analysis empowers organizations to thrive in today's data-driven world.

The role of big data analysis is to help organizations make informed decisions based on large and complex data sets. Here are five key points outlining the importance of big data analysis:
-
Improved Decision-Making: Big data analysis allows organizations to analyze vast amounts of data from various sources to gain valuable insights. This enables decision-makers to make informed and data-driven decisions across different functions such as marketing, product development, customer service, and operations.
-
Identifying Trends and Patterns: Big data analysis can help organizations identify trends and patterns that are not immediately apparent. By analyzing large data sets, organizations can uncover hidden insights that can be used to identify market trends, customer preferences, and opportunities for growth.
-
Predictive Analytics: Big data analysis enables organizations to use predictive analytics to forecast future trends and outcomes. By applying advanced algorithms to historical data, organizations can predict customer behavior, market trends, and potential business risks, allowing them to take proactive measures to mitigate risks and capitalize on opportunities.
-
Personalized Marketing and Customer Experience: Big data analysis allows organizations to segment their customer base and target specific customer groups with personalized marketing messages and offers. By analyzing customer data and behavior patterns, organizations can create personalized experiences that meet the unique needs and preferences of individual customers, leading to increased customer satisfaction and loyalty.
-
Operational Efficiency and Cost Reduction: Big data analysis can help organizations optimize their operations and reduce costs. By analyzing data on supply chain, production processes, and performance metrics, organizations can identify inefficiencies, streamline processes, and improve overall operational efficiency. This data-driven approach can help organizations reduce costs, improve productivity, and ultimately increase profitability.
In conclusion, big data analysis plays a crucial role in helping organizations make informed decisions, identify trends and patterns, leverage predictive analytics, personalize marketing and customer experiences, and enhance operational efficiency. By harnessing the power of big data, organizations can gain a competitive edge, drive innovation, and achieve business success.

The Role of Big Data Analysis
With the rapid advancement of technology, the amount of data generated by various sources has increased tremendously, leading to the emergence of big data. Big data analysis is the process of examining large and complex data sets to uncover hidden patterns, unknown correlations, market trends, customer preferences, and other useful information. The role of big data analysis is crucial in today's data-driven world as it helps businesses and organizations make informed decisions, improve operations, drive innovation, and gain a competitive edge. Below, we will delve into the various aspects of big data analysis, including methods, processes, and benefits.
Understanding Big Data Analysis
Definition of Big Data Analysis:
Big data analysis refers to the process of analyzing and interpreting large and complex data sets to derive insights and make informed decisions. It involves collecting, storing, processing, and analyzing massive volumes of data from diverse sources, including social media, sensors, transactions, and more.Characteristics of Big Data:
Big data is typically characterized by the 3Vs:- Volume: Refers to the massive amounts of data generated and collected.
- Velocity: Relates to the speed at which data is generated and processed in real-time.
- Variety: Encompasses the different types and sources of data, such as structured, unstructured, and semi-structured data.
Importance of Big Data Analysis:
Big data analysis plays a vital role in various industries and sectors, including:- Business: Helps in understanding customer behavior, market trends, and competition.
- Healthcare: Enables personalized medicine, disease prediction, and healthcare management.
- Finance: Supports risk management, fraud detection, and algorithmic trading.
- Marketing: Facilitates targeted advertising, customer segmentation, and campaign optimization.
- Manufacturing: Improves supply chain management, predictive maintenance, and quality control.
Methods of Big Data Analysis
1. Descriptive Analysis:
Descriptive analysis involves summarizing and interpreting historical data to gain insights into past trends and patterns. It includes techniques such as data visualization, summarization, and clustering.2. Diagnostic Analysis:
Diagnostic analysis focuses on understanding why certain events occurred by identifying causal relationships between variables. It involves techniques like regression analysis, root cause analysis, and hypothesis testing.3. Predictive Analysis:
Predictive analysis aims to forecast future outcomes based on historical data and statistical modeling. It includes techniques such as machine learning, time series analysis, and predictive modeling.4. Prescriptive Analysis:
Prescriptive analysis recommends the best course of action to achieve a specific goal or outcome. It involves optimization techniques, simulation modeling, and decision analysis.Process of Big Data Analysis
1. Data Collection:
The first step in big data analysis is collecting data from various sources, such as social media, websites, sensors, and databases. Data can be structured, unstructured, or semi-structured.2. Data Preprocessing:
Data preprocessing involves cleaning, transforming, and preparing raw data for analysis. It includes tasks like data integration, data cleaning, data reduction, and data normalization.3. Data Analysis:
The next step is to apply various analytical techniques to the preprocessed data to extract valuable insights. This includes descriptive, diagnostic, predictive, and prescriptive analysis.4. Data Visualization:
Data visualization is essential for communicating insights effectively through charts, graphs, dashboards, and reports. It helps stakeholders understand complex data in a visual format.5. Interpretation and Reporting:
